Output 81a16ba4e18cb4f0dba149b129f865fde5f402a10cb75f07ce783b831dfbaf0a:0

value
1969847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c181383dbc58e608970c326d78f1b62d0eaefb2 OP_EQUAL
address
3Qfy3jLs2wf9hF37awDcUHgmR8AXXnDNeG
transaction
81a16ba4e18cb4f0dba149b129f865fde5f402a10cb75f07ce783b831dfbaf0a
spent
true